Kia Carens surpasses 3 lakh cumulative sales milestone in India

Kia India has announced that the Carens family has crossed 3 lakh cumulative sales in the country. The milestone comes as the lineup expands with the Carens Clavis and Carens Clavis EV, offering petrol, diesel and electric powertrains to cater to evolving family mobility needs.

Kia India has announced that the Kia Carens family has crossed the 3 lakh cumulative sales milestone in the Indian market, reinforcing its position as one of the brand’s most successful mass-premium offerings and a key player in the country’s recreational vehicle segment.

Responding to the evolving aspirations of Indian families, Kia introduced Carens Clavis EV.

The Carens Clavis EV combines spacious design, versatile seating with options of both 6- & 7-seater and electric innovation, making it a compelling choice for customers exploring practical EV options. Powered by 99kW & 126kW motor delivering 255 Nm torque, it offers smooth performance across commutes and road trips, with dual battery options—51.4 kWh (490 km range) and 42 kWh (404 km range)—and fast charging from 10% to 80% in just 39 minutes.

The Carens sales mix reflects changing customer preferences. Petrol variants account for 60%, followed by diesel with 30% and EV with 10% of cumulative sales. While Clavis EV offers best in the segment range, there is strong acceptance of Kia’s refined and efficient gasoline powertrains even in the family movers.

Equipped with both 6-and 7-seater with unique blend of space & comfort, Carens can accommodate large families and varied travel requirements. Meanwhile, 18% contribution from top trims reflects growing customer willingness to invest in advanced safety features, connected technologies, and premium comfort amenities.
